Getting error when migrating Power BI report server databases to another host

We are using Power BI report server Jan 2023 version.

 

We are trying to migrate PBI RS databases from host A (sql server 2017 standard) to host B (sql server 2019 standard) . I am following instructions as provided here - https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/sql/reporting-services/report-server/moving-the-report-server-data... 

 

However, when i am trying to update data source (to use Host B) on Reporting server config manager, it gives error - "This Edition of Reporting Services requires that you use local SQL Server relational databases".

This seems weird as we are using SQL Server 2019 Standard edition on the new host B.

 

Please let me know if anyone else have encountered this issue with PBI RS Jan 2023 version , and possible workaround ?

What edition does the Configuration Manager report when you start it up? My local version is using a developer install, but a production one should say "Power BI Report Server - Enterprise"

If the edition is reported incorrectly you might need to raise a support ticket with Microsoft.

 

If the edition is correct then does the user doing the migration have SysAdmin rights on the new SQL Server instance. They only need this during the database configuration, but the config tool tries to check SQL Agent and configure roles so it needs these elevated permissions.
